Beyma 12CMV3
Paramètres Thiele-Small
| Taille nominale | 12" |
|---|---|
| Impédance | 8 Ω |
| Fs | 52 Hz |
| Qts | 0.55 |
| Qes | 0.58 |
| Qms | 10.6 |
| Vas | 85 L |
| Sd | 530 cm² |
| Xmax | 7 mm |
| Re | 6.1 Ω |
| Bl | 12.3 T·m |
| Mms | 44 g |
| Pe | 320 W |
| Sensibilité | 96.5 dB |
